One of the most important representatives of Naturopathy in the twentieth century has been Bernard Jensen (1908 – 2001), who developed an integral and holistic concept of health. He took into account nutrition, body movement, contact with clean air and water and the correction of unhealthy ways of eating and living.

Bernhard Aschner (1883-1960) Austrian doctor and follower of proven natural principles, actualized and systematized the Humoral- treatments with the application of cups. These techniques were already known in China and India for 3500 years, and in Egypt around 2200 BC and afterwards from Hippocrates, Galen and Avicenna among other well-known doctors.
